PH economic growth rate slows down to 4.3%

The growth of the Philippine economy slowed to 4.3 percent in the second quarter of the year, from the 6.4 percent expansion in the first quarter, the Philippine Statistics Authority (PSA) reported on Thursday. Best of the Best Developer-Firms Bag Pillar Awards

Ayala Land and Vista Land were honored as exemplary developers, while thirteen other firms from 5 regional groupings across the country were named Developers of the Decade, during the Pillar Awards ceremonies capping the CREBA Golden Jubilee National Convention last Thursday at the Conrad Manila. Industry confab ratifies housing priorities

In the largest gathering of industry players and practitioners seen in the last decade, the real estate and housing sector under the umbrella of the Chamber of Real Estate & Builders’ Associations (CREBA) unanimously endorsed the Chamber’s updated 5-Point Agenda and advocacy priorities. Davao Sur is 7th Most Competitive Province Nationwide

Davao Sur is 7th Most Competitive Province Nationwide The Provincial Government of Davao del Sur headed by Gov. Yvonne Roña Cagas was recently cited by the Department of Trade and Industry (DTI) as the 7th Overall Most Competitive Province nationwide in the Cities and Municipalities Competitive Index (CMCI). DavNor infra projects to boost real estate investments

Benefitting from massive infrastructure projects, Davao del Norte and De Oro are fast emerging as economically vibrant areas and real estate investment hubs in Mindanao.
